## Canary gating — Pellwright deploys

Canaries on Pellwright promote only when three gates pass: error rate below baseline for 15 minutes, p95 latency within 10% of blue, and zero failed health probes. Reviewers should verify that gate thresholds in the PR match this runbook exactly. Gate evaluations are fetched from the internal Sentinet service, which requires authentication. Use the read-only key that follows.

service key, fawip-bajef: kto11_Qt5wZK9vdNC

Step 4: Decommission the legacy Quenchline job queue. All pending jobs must be drained via the Harkwell admin console before cutover, and the worker pool scaled to zero. Verify that the new Bramblet dispatcher holds exclusive write access to the jobs schema, and that audit logging is enabled. The dispatcher reads its target database from the line below.

replica DSN, yahaf-yagaf: mongodb://tamath_svc:a2netSk3RZMuTj@db-d084.novacsoft.internal:5432/ralmir

Priority: P2. Owner: Dray.

Snapshot suite for the Lumabyte design kit fails intermittently on CI but passes locally. Root cause looks like font metrics differing between the runner image and dev machines, shifting baselines by 1px. Proposed fix: pin the renderer image and regenerate goldens. Affects 14 components; ButtonCluster and TabRail worst. Blocking the Pinefold release branch until resolved. Repro is deterministic on the runner — see the failing build reference below.

trace token, fafog-kageg: htk4_98e6